International Trucks Advertising Poster
Advertising poster for International trucks. Features an illustration of men using an International heavy-duty truck at a subway construction site, a list of IHC branches across the nation, and the text: "In the Subways of New York." This poster design was also used for publication in "The Saturday Evening Post," "Collier's," "Literary Digest," and "Liberty." |
